Unlocking the Podcast Brain: How Audio Shapes Our Minds

The twilight air hung still in the Brooklyn neighborhood, a symphony of urban quietude. A man, a resident for a year, stopped dead in his tracks. The sound was unfamiliar, alien almost. Then it dawned on him: crickets. Chirping crickets, a soundscape he'd unknowingly muted for months, perhaps years, by the constant stream of podcasts piped directly into his ears. This wasn't just a personal anecdote; it was a symptom of a larger phenomenon: the podcast boom and its subtle, yet profound, impact on our brains.

Podcasts, once a niche hobby, have exploded into a global industry. From true crime to self-help, comedy to in-depth news analysis, there's a podcast for every conceivable interest. But what is all this auditory input doing to our cognitive landscape? Are we enriching our minds, or are we simply filling a void, inadvertently altering the way we perceive and interact with the world?

Adam Clark Estes, a senior technology correspondent at Vox, experienced this firsthand. His realization about the crickets sparked a month-long podcast detox. "It was one of the first times I'd walked through it without AirPods jammed into my ears," he wrote. This simple act of removing the constant auditory stimulation revealed a previously unnoticed layer of reality.

The implications of this constant connectivity are significant. Neuroscientists are beginning to explore how habitual podcast consumption affects attention spans, memory, and even our sense of presence. The human brain is remarkably adaptable, constantly rewiring itself based on experiences. When we consistently outsource our attention to external sources, like podcasts, we may be weakening our ability to focus and be present in the moment.

"Our brains are designed to filter information and prioritize what's important," explains Dr. Anya Sharma, a cognitive neuroscientist at the Institute for Brain Health. "When we're constantly bombarded with auditory input, the brain can become overwhelmed, leading to a decrease in cognitive flexibility and an increased susceptibility to distraction."

Furthermore, the parasocial relationships we form with podcast hosts can blur the lines between real connection and simulated intimacy. We may feel like we know these voices intimately, sharing their thoughts and experiences, but the relationship is inherently one-sided. This can potentially lead to feelings of loneliness and isolation, despite the constant presence of these virtual companions.

The rise of AI-generated podcasts further complicates the landscape. Algorithms can now create realistic-sounding voices and generate content on virtually any topic. While this technology offers exciting possibilities for personalized learning and entertainment, it also raises ethical concerns about authenticity and the potential for manipulation. Imagine a future where AI-generated podcasts are tailored to exploit our cognitive biases and reinforce existing beliefs.

"We need to be mindful of the potential downsides of these technologies," warns Dr. Sharma. "It's crucial to cultivate a healthy balance between consuming information and engaging with the world around us. Taking breaks from technology, practicing mindfulness, and prioritizing real-life interactions are essential for maintaining cognitive well-being."

The podcast revolution has undoubtedly transformed the way we consume information and connect with others. However, it's imperative that we approach this technology with awareness and intention. By understanding the potential impact of podcasts on our brains, we can make informed choices about how we use them, ensuring that they enhance, rather than detract from, our cognitive and emotional well-being. The chirping crickets serve as a potent reminder: sometimes, the most enriching experiences are found in the quiet spaces between the noise.
